#!/usr/bin/env python3
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Apply subscription-table constraints and indexes safely on existing SQLite databases.
|
||||
|
||||
This migration performs:
|
||||
1) Deduplication of `usage_summaries` rows by (user_id, billing_period).
|
||||
2) Deduplication of `subscription_renewal_history` rows by renewal event tuple.
|
||||
3) Creation of unique and performance indexes used by subscription usage queries.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
|
||||
import argparse
|
||||
import sqlite3
|
||||
import sys
|
||||
from pathlib import Path
|
||||
from typing import List, Optional
|
||||
|
||||
from loguru import logger
|
||||
|
||||
# Add the backend directory to Python path
|
||||
backend_dir = Path(__file__).parent.parent
|
||||
sys.path.insert(0, str(backend_dir))
|
||||
|
||||
from services.database import get_all_user_ids, get_user_db_path
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
API_USAGE_INDEXES = [
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_api_usage_logs_user_id ON api_usage_logs (user_id)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_api_usage_logs_billing_period ON api_usage_logs (billing_period)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_api_usage_logs_timestamp ON api_usage_logs (timestamp)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_api_usage_logs_provider ON api_usage_logs (provider)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_api_usage_logs_user_period ON api_usage_logs (user_id, billing_period)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_api_usage_logs_user_provider_period ON api_usage_logs (user_id, provider, billing_period)",
|
||||
]
|
||||
|
||||
USAGE_SUMMARY_INDEXES = [
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_usage_summaries_user_period ON usage_summaries (user_id, billing_period)",
|
||||
"CREATE UNIQUE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S uq_usage_summaries_user_period ON usage_summaries (user_id, billing_period)",
|
||||
]
|
||||
|
||||
RENEWAL_HISTORY_INDEXES = [
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_subscription_renewal_history_user_id ON subscription_renewal_history (user_id)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_subscription_renewal_history_created_at ON subscription_renewal_history (created_at)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_subscription_renewal_history_user_created ON subscription_renewal_history (user_id, created_at)",
|
||||
"C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_subscription_renewal_history_user_period ON subscription_renewal_history (user_id, new_period_start, new_period_end)",
|
||||
"CREATE UNIQUE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S uq_subscription_renewal_event ON subscription_renewal_history (user_id, new_period_start, new_period_end, renewal_type)",
|
||||
]
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def table_exists(cursor: sqlite3.Cursor, table_name: str) -> bool:
|
||||
cursor.execute(
|
||||
"SELECT 1 FROM sqlite_master WHERE type='table' AND name = ?",
|
||||
(table_name,),
|
||||
)
|
||||
return cursor.fetchone() is not None
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def dedupe_usage_summaries(cursor: sqlite3.Cursor) -> int:
|
||||
"""Keep the most recently updated row per (user_id, billing_period)."""
|
||||
cursor.execute(
|
||||
"""
|
||||
SELECT user_id, billing_period, COUNT(*)
|
||||
FROM usage_summaries
|
||||
GROUP BY user_id, billing_period
|
||||
HAVING COUNT(*) > 1
|
||||
"""
|
||||
)
|
||||
duplicates = cursor.fetchall()
|
||||
|
||||
removed = 0
|
||||
for user_id, billing_period, _ in duplicates:
|
||||
cursor.execute(
|
||||
"""
|
||||
SELECT id
|
||||
FROM usage_summaries
|
||||
WHERE user_id = ? AND billing_period = ?
|
||||
ORDER BY
|
||||
CASE WHEN updated_at IS NULL THEN 1 ELSE 0 END,
|
||||
updated_at DESC,
|
||||
CASE WHEN created_at IS NULL THEN 1 ELSE 0 END,
|
||||
created_at DESC,
|
||||
id DESC
|
||||
LIMIT 1
|
||||
""",
|
||||
(user_id, billing_period),
|
||||
)
|
||||
keeper = cursor.fetchone()
|
||||
if not keeper:
|
||||
continue
|
||||
|
||||
keeper_id = keeper[0]
|
||||
cursor.execute(
|
||||
"DELETE FROM usage_summaries WHERE user_id = ? AND billing_period = ? AND id != ?",
|
||||
(user_id, billing_period, keeper_id),
|
||||
)
|
||||
removed += cursor.rowcount
|
||||
|
||||
return removed
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def dedupe_renewal_history(cursor: sqlite3.Cursor) -> int:
|
||||
"""Keep latest row per renewal event tuple used by the unique constraint."""
|
||||
cursor.execute(
|
||||
"""
|
||||
SELECT user_id, new_period_start, new_period_end, renewal_type, COUNT(*)
|
||||
FROM subscription_renewal_history
|
||||
GROUP BY user_id, new_period_start, new_period_end, renewal_type
|
||||
HAVING COUNT(*) > 1
|
||||
"""
|
||||
)
|
||||
duplicates = cursor.fetchall()
|
||||
|
||||
removed = 0
|
||||
for user_id, new_period_start, new_period_end, renewal_type, _ in duplicates:
|
||||
cursor.execute(
|
||||
"""
|
||||
SELECT id
|
||||
FROM subscription_renewal_history
|
||||
WHERE user_id = ?
|
||||
AND new_period_start = ?
|
||||
AND new_period_end = ?
|
||||
AND renewal_type = ?
|
||||
ORDER BY
|
||||
CASE WHEN created_at IS NULL THEN 1 ELSE 0 END,
|
||||
created_at DESC,
|
||||
id DESC
|
||||
LIMIT 1
|
||||
""",
|
||||
(user_id, new_period_start, new_period_end, renewal_type),
|
||||
)
|
||||
keeper = cursor.fetchone()
|
||||
if not keeper:
|
||||
continue
|
||||
|
||||
keeper_id = keeper[0]
|
||||
cursor.execute(
|
||||
"""
|
||||
DELETE FROM subscription_renewal_history
|
||||
WHERE user_id = ?
|
||||
AND new_period_start = ?
|
||||
AND new_period_end = ?
|
||||
AND renewal_type = ?
|
||||
AND id != ?
|
||||
""",
|
||||
(user_id, new_period_start, new_period_end, renewal_type, keeper_id),
|
||||
)
|
||||
removed += cursor.rowcount
|
||||
|
||||
return removed
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def run_migration_for_db(db_path: Path) -> bool:
|
||||
if not db_path.exists():
|
||||
logger.warning(f"Skipping missing database: {db_path}")
|
||||
return True
|
||||
|
||||
logger.info(f"Running subscription constraint migration for: {db_path}")
|
||||
|
||||
connection = sqlite3.connect(str(db_path))
|
||||
cursor = connection.cursor()
|
||||
|
||||
try:
|
||||
cursor.execute("BEGIN")
|
||||
|
||||
if table_exists(cursor, "usage_summaries"):
|
||||
removed = dedupe_usage_summaries(cursor)
|
||||
logger.info(f"usage_summaries dedupe removed {removed} duplicate row(s)")
|
||||
for statement in USAGE_SUMMARY_INDEXES:
|
||||
cursor.execute(statement)
|
||||
else:
|
||||
logger.warning("Table usage_summaries not found; skipping related constraints")
|
||||
|
||||
if table_exists(cursor, "api_usage_logs"):
|
||||
for statement in API_USAGE_INDEXES:
|
||||
cursor.execute(statement)
|
||||
else:
|
||||
logger.warning("Table api_usage_logs not found; skipping related indexes")
|
||||
|
||||
if table_exists(cursor, "subscription_renewal_history"):
|
||||
removed = dedupe_renewal_history(cursor)
|
||||
logger.info(f"subscription_renewal_history dedupe removed {removed} duplicate row(s)")
|
||||
for statement in RENEWAL_HISTORY_INDEXES:
|
||||
cursor.execute(statement)
|
||||
else:
|
||||
logger.warning("Table subscription_renewal_history not found; skipping related constraints")
|
||||
|
||||
connection.commit()
|
||||
logger.info("✅ Migration completed successfully")
|
||||
return True
|
||||
except Exception as exc:
|
||||
connection.rollback()
|
||||
logger.error(f"❌ Migration failed for {db_path}: {exc}")
|
||||
return False
|
||||
finally:
|
||||
connection.close()
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def resolve_targets(user_id: Optional[str]) -> List[Path]:
|
||||
if user_id:
|
||||
return [Path(get_user_db_path(user_id))]
|
||||
|
||||
user_ids = get_all_user_ids()
|
||||
return [Path(get_user_db_path(uid)) for uid in user_ids]
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def main() -> int:
|
||||
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(
|
||||
description="Apply subscription usage constraints/indexes and dedupe old rows.",
|
||||
)
|
||||
parser.add_argument("--user_id", help="Target one user database instead of all discovered users")
|
||||
args = parser.parse_args()
|
||||
|
||||
targets = resolve_targets(args.user_id)
|
||||
if not targets:
|
||||
logger.warning("No user databases discovered. Nothing to migrate.")
|
||||
return 0
|
||||
|
||||
failures = 0
|
||||
for db_path in targets:
|
||||
success = run_migration_for_db(db_path)
|
||||
if not success:
|
||||
failures += 1
|
||||
|
||||
if failures:
|
||||
logger.error(f"Migration finished with {failures} failure(s)")
|
||||
return 1
|
||||
|
||||
logger.info("All targeted databases migrated successfully")
|
||||
return 0
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
if __name__ == "__main__":
|
||||
raise SystemExit(main())
